The administration of US President Joe Biden sent an urgent warning to Congress on December 4 about the need to approve tens of billions of dollars in military and economic aid to Ukraine, AP reports.

In the letter, Office of Management and Budget Director Shalanda Young warned that without this help, Ukraine's military efforts to defend against a Russian invasion could grind to a halt.

According to her, by the end of the year the United States will run out of funds to provide weapons and assistance, adding that the money it used to support the Ukrainian economy has already run out, and “if it falls, they will not be able to continue fighting, period.”

“We're out of money and almost out of time,” Yang noted.

Congress has already allocated $111 billion in aid to Ukraine, including $67 billion for military procurement, $27 billion for economic and civilian assistance and $10 billion for humanitarian assistance. However, as Young writes, all of these funds, with the exception of about 3% of military funding, were exhausted by mid-November.

– This is not a problem for next year. The time to help democratic Ukraine fight against Russian aggression is now. It's time for Congress to act, she said.

Back in October, US President Joe Biden submitted a $106 billion request to Congress. It provided for the allocation of $61.3 billion for Ukraine within a year and about $14 billion for Israel.

But on November 2, the House of Representatives passed a bill providing $14.3 billion in aid to Israel. It does not contain funds for Ukraine.
